Samsung launches SyncMaster 80 Series LCD Monitors

July 14, 2009 By kunal 4 Comments

Samsung SyncMaster 80 Series

 

Samsung has unveiled the 80 Series SyncMaster LCD monitors in Korea. The 20- and 23-inch, F2080 and F2380 respectively will ship from September 14 and brings in number of features to woo the professional class.

The SyncMaster 80 Series boasts a viewing angle of 178 degrees, has a static contrast of 3000:1 while the dynamic goes up to 150,000:1, up to 100% sRGB support and is certified by TCO.

The F2080 will sell for KRW 378,000 (USD 292) and F2380 for KRW 457,000 (USD 353).
